探秘 Koishi 插件 OpenAI:解锁 AI 辅助聊天的新篇章
在如今的智能时代,人工智能已经深入到我们生活的方方面面,而聊天机器人就是其中的一个重要领域。今天我们要介绍的是一个基于 ,它能够让你的聊天应用获得强大的 AI 聊天功能,借助 OpenAI 的 GPT-3 等模型,与用户进行自然、流畅的对话。
项目简介
Koishi Plugin OpenAI 是一款为 Koishi 平台设计的插件,它集成了 OpenAI 的 API,允许开发者轻松地将高级别的自然语言处理能力注入自己的聊天机器人中。通过这款插件,你可以让你的机器人具备回答问题、提供信息、甚至进行创造性思考的能力。
技术分析
核心特性
-
无缝集成 - Koishi 插件系统的设计使得安装和配置
koishi-plugin-openai
非常简单,只需几步即可让机器人开始使用 OpenAI 模型。 -
高效调用 - 该插件使用了高效的 API 调用策略,以降低延迟并优化资源利用,确保机器人能够快速响应用户的输入。
-
深度定制 - 开发者可以通过事件监听和中间件机制,根据需要自定义机器人的行为,比如设定特定场景下的回复策略。
-
模型兼容 - 支持多种 OpenAI 提供的模型,可以根据需求选择不同的模型以达到最佳效果,例如 GPT-3, Codex 等。
使用流程
-
安装插件:
npm install koishi-plugin-openai
-
在你的 Koishi 应用中加载插件并配置 API 密钥:
const { createApp } = require('koishi') const openaiPlugin = require('koishi-plugin-openai') const app = createApp() app.use(openaiPlugin, { apiKey: 'your_openai_api_key', })
-
设定交互规则或监听事件,开始享受 AI 助手带来的便利!
应用场景
- 客服支持 - 自动化处理常见客户问题,减轻人工客服压力。
- 教育辅导 - 为学生提供实时的学习帮助和答疑解惑。
- 娱乐互动 - 创造有趣、富有创意的聊天体验,提升用户粘性。
- 内容生成 - 自动生成新闻摘要、编写故事、创作诗歌等。
- 代码辅助 - 帮助程序员理解代码逻辑,提出修改建议。
特点亮点
- 易用性 - 对于初学者友好,文档清晰,示例丰富。
- 灵活性 - 可与其他 Koishi 插件配合,构建复杂的应用场景。
- 可扩展性 - 模型更新和新功能添加简单,保持与时俱进。
- 安全可控 - 可以设置敏感词过滤,保障对话内容的安全性。
结语
如果你正在寻找一种方式让你的聊天机器人变得更加聪明和活跃,那么 Koishi Plugin OpenAI 绝对是一个值得尝试的选择。无论你是开发者还是爱好者,都可以借此项目开启 AI 聊天机器人的新旅程。现在就访问项目链接,加入社区,开始你的探索之旅吧!
让我们一起,用代码赋予机器人智慧,创造更美好的交流体验!